Chapter 6: Console Configuration
The Patch Output Display
248/ 526 2.0 Eclipse User Guide
PATCH Tabs
Side Tabs
The three tabs on the left of the display allow you to choose
different categories of system output:
LOCAL / MUXI the Muxipaire outputs (I/O cards fitted
at the rear of the console or in a remote Stagebox).
DSP LINE the 16 Line Level outputs on the DSP card
at the rear of the console.
DIO1 the 64 channels feeding the Ethersound
network. See Page 263.
Note that if you select either the DSP LINE or LOCAL / MUXI
tabs, then the following information appears at the bottom left of
the display:
For technical reasons, you may only patch up to 32 mix busses
to Muxipaire interfaces. These are the I/O cards at the rear of
the console (Local) or in a Muxipaire Stagebox (Distant). The
display counter shows the number of local and distant busses
which have been patched. There is no limit on mix bus patching
within the DIO1 grid (Ethersound network).
Top Tabs
The top tabs access additional grids for patching and
configuring the Ethersound network or Muxipaire interface (see
Pages 263 and 285.
